[edit] Etymology
From glutar- + aldehyde; compare glutaric acid, glutaryl, glutarate.
[edit] Noun
glutaraldehyde (plural glutaraldehydes)
- (uncountable) The chemical substance having the IUPAC name pentane-1,5-dial, a toxic liquid with a pungent odor.
- (countable) Any specific preparation or solution of glutaraldehyde.
